Course Content

• Fundamentals of Nanotechnology
• Nanomaterials for Aquaculture Applications (including biosensors and drug delivery)
• Nanobiotechnology in Aquaculture: Disease Diagnostics and Treatment
• Nanotechnology for Water Quality Improvement in Aquaculture
• Sustainable Aquaculture Practices using Nanotechnology
• Risk Assessment and Environmental Impact of Nanomaterials in Aquaculture
• Nanomaterial Synthesis and Characterization for Aquaculture
• Commercialization and Entrepreneurship in Nanotechnology for Aquaculture

Career Role Description
Nanomaterials Scientist (Aquaculture) Develop and apply nanomaterials for improved fish health, feed efficiency, and water quality. High demand for expertise in biocompatible nanomaterials.
Nanobiotechnologist (Aquaculture) Specialize in the biological applications of nanotechnology within aquaculture, focusing on disease diagnostics and treatment using nanocarriers. Strong background in biology and nanotechnology needed.
Aquaculture Engineer (Nanotechnology Focus) Design and implement nanotechnology-based solutions for aquaculture systems, optimizing efficiency and sustainability. Experience with sensors and automation systems advantageous.
Data Scientist (Aquaculture Nanotechnology) Analyze large datasets generated from nanotechnology applications in aquaculture. Proficient in programming languages like R or Python, and statistical analysis.
